Subject: Rotated key — Branchreaper bot

Heads up for on-call: the credential Branchreaper uses to prune stale branches in the Coderill monorepo was rotated this morning. The old key stops working at 18:00 UTC. If the bot pages with auth failures after that, restart it once — it reloads secrets on boot. No other action needed. New key for the bot is below.

service key, yadug-bajog: zpat3_pou

Subject: locale-extract script patched

On-call: the Fennelworks translation-string extraction script was dropping pluralized keys when source files used nested template literals. Patched in tonight's run. If the localization pipeline pages you, rerun extract with the --strict flag and diff against the last good catalog; a clean diff means the fix held. Known issue: warnings about empty contexts are noise, ignore them. Escalate only if key counts drop by more than 2%. The fixed build's token is below.

pipeline stamp: htk31_f769b577b3028a4e9958e5bb8d1259a

## Tuning

The Vantrel session-token refresh bug stemmed from refresh attempts racing the expiry window. Fix: widen the pre-expiry refresh margin and cap concurrent refreshes per client. Do not ship without verifying against the auth soak test. Rollback is safe; values are config-only. The constants shipping in this release are as follows.

tuning table, fawip-fahag:
WEIGHTS = {
    "novwyn": 452,
    "casdor": 675,
}

# Break-Glass: Catalog Cache Invalidation

Scope: the Pinrow product catalog at Veldstone Retail. If stale prices persist after a purge and the Hollowmere invalidation queue is wedged, use break-glass to flush the edge tier directly. Contractors: get verbal sign-off from the catalog lead first. Steps: open the Hollowmere admin shell, select emergency-flush, confirm the tenant, and run it once — repeated flushes thrash the origin. Access is logged and expires after 20 minutes. Unseal the admin shell with the passphrase below.

recovery phrase for kahop-tajog: istix-casvan